Paharpur is a Rural village located in Gauriganj, Amethi, Uttar-pradesh.
The total population of Paharpur is 494.
Paharpur village comprises 79 households.
The literacy rate in Paharpur is 68.4%. Among the literate population of 294, there are 173 literate males and 121 literate females.
In Paharpur, there are 249 males and 245 females, with a sex ratio of 984 females per 1000 males.
There are 64 children (13% of population), comprising 32 boys and 32 girls.
The total number of workers in Paharpur is 206, with 66 main workers and 140 marginal workers.
In Paharpur, there are 174 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(86 males, 88 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Paharpur is located in Uttar-pradesh state, Amethi district, and falls under Gauriganj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 169254 and LGD code is 169254.
